*Position: Business Analyst with LifeRay*

*Location: Lincolnshire, IL*

*Duration: 7 Months  (Possible extension to mid of next year)*


*Business Analyst:*

*Job Description: *Responsible for interfacing with stakeholders and
creating user stories for various business requirements.  Should be able to
devise solutions for the user problems and propose these solutions to
stakeholders.

Business Analyst with Agile.  *Knowledge or experience in Liferay / Portal
development, Good communication.*

* Roles & Responsibilities:*

·         Conduct requirement gathering sessions and review meetings with
business sponsors and members of the development team, domain guidance
liaison to ensure understanding of the new functionalities.

·         Determine impact of functional requirements through collaboration
with other feature team members on various aspects of existing system.

·         Support design team in the translation of Medium fidelity design
into High fidelity designs.

·         Work closely with UX team to facilitate updates to med-fi and
communicate the updates to UI dev team.

·         Work closely with Technical Architect to identify the stories for
the Sprint after reviewing all the dependencies and make sure that all the
required details are worked out.

·         Create stories in JIRA and populate the Acceptance Criteria.

·         Participate in SL demo after the stories are complete in a sprint
and provide signoff.

·         Create power point presentation to demo the stories from each
Sprint to business sponsor through Show N Tell.

·         Participate in all remaining phases of Sprint to verify that the
design is installed, configured and documented correctly.

·         Review test cases and provide feedback to ensure that all
functional aspects have been covered and provide sign off.

·         Participate in UAT by writing scenarios for applicable
functionalities and work with QA team to ensure that required data set up
has been done to test the scenarios.

·         Participate in Defect review meetings to ensure defects are
prioritized, tracked, reported on and resolved in a timely manner and
communicate the status back to stakeholders and update the same in tracker.

·         Support end users during execution of External User Acceptance
Testing.

·         Track and maintain user requested enhancements and changes
